12 ounces Bloody Mary Mix
1 cup water
Tabasco Sauce to taste
4 strips bacon, cooked and crumbled
6 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on chopped garlic
1/2 cup chopped onion
2 stalks celery, chopped
1 cup long grain rice
Combine Bloody Mary Mix, water, Tabasco Sauce, crumbled bacon, butter, garlic,
onion, and celery and bring to boil. Add rice, reduce heat to simmer, cover
and cook about 25 minutes until all liquid is absorbed.
